Some nationality citizens can receive the entry visa in the airport in Egypt such as USA, UK European Union Nationals, Australia, Canada, Georgia, Japan, New Zealand, Norway, Macedonia, Malaysia, Republic of Korea, Russian Federation, Serbia, South Korea and Ukraine The others can apply for visa to Egyptian consulate in his home country it is easy and takes few days to issue.

We recommend booking your family trip to Egypt between October and April. During these months, the weather is much cooler, making it perfect for sightseeing and exploring Egypt’s iconic landmarks, like the Pyramids of Giza, Karnak Temple, and the Valley of the Kings. These months also feature lower crowds, allowing for a more peaceful and enjoyable experience for your family. A Dahabiya cruise is one of the most luxurious and intimate ways to explore the Nile River. Unlike traditional Nile cruises, Dahabiyas are smaller, more traditional boats that offer a personalized experience with fewer passengers. You’ll have the chance to explore historic temples, such as Kom Ombo and Edfu, without the large crowds found on bigger cruise ships.

The Eye of Ra is one of the most powerful Egyptian symbols, representing the sun god Ra and associated with protection and strength. In ancient Egyptian mythology, it was used as a symbol of power and a protective force against enemies and evil. As part of your ancient Egypt tour, you’ll likely encounter the Eye of Ra in temple depictions and artifacts. This symbol remains a key element of Egyptian culture and can often be found in jewelry and modern interpretations of Egyptian art. A Nile River cruise between Luxor and Aswan offers the opportunity to explore some of Egypt's most remarkable landmarks. Popular stops include the majestic Luxor, the awe-inspiring Edfu Temple, the impressive Kom Ombo Temple, and the historical city of Aswan, where you can discover the beauty of ancient Egyptian culture along the banks of the Nile.

The Ankh symbol is one of the most important Egyptian symbols, representing life, immortality, and prosperity. It was often depicted in ancient Egyptian art and hieroglyphs and was believed to grant eternal life to the deceased. On our Ancient Egypt Tour, you’ll encounter the Ankh symbol in temples and tombs. It's an integral part of Egyptian spirituality, symbolizing the cycle of life and death.
